**Action Item (Postmortem PM-47, Larkfield wiki outage):** Audit role-based access rules in Larkfield. Contractors inherited editor rights via a stale group mapping, letting an automated cleanup script delete protected pages. Owner: platform team. Due: next sprint. Deliverables: remove legacy group inheritance, add deny-by-default for automation accounts, and ship a weekly permissions diff report. Track progress at the weekly eng sync. The remediation checklist and current audit status are on the internal page below.

operations page: https://jenkins.zemvarcloud.local/job/merge_requests/repo/build/73930b4b30f0a8ed

Release managers on the Millbrook wiki hold the Publisher role, which gates page-freeze and space-export actions. If your role assignment is lost during a directory sync, do not request a new account; instead, restore the original one so audit history stays intact. The recovery flow will prompt for the passphrase that follows below.

vault phrase of bagaf-kajeg = jorath-feniel-briir-siliel-ralix

Q3 planning note. The Varnick licensing dispute over the Claribel toolkit is unresolved. Legal expects mediation by mid-quarter. Until then, do not quote Claribel bundles to new accounts; renewals proceed as normal. Pricing holds at current rates. Tomas Ren owns escalations. Direction for next quarter depends on the outcome below.

board note of kagep-yahig: Only 9 of the 120 pilot accounts renewed Quenix, so a churn review is set for April 1.